National Competition Commission (Conacom)
Location
The National Competition Commission, known as Conacom, operates within Paraguay. It is a regulatory body responsible for overseeing and ensuring fair competition within the country's markets.
Important Events
One of the significant recent events involving Conacom was the approval of a merger under Resolution D/AL No. 51/2025. This decision was made in accordance with Paraguay's Competition Defense Law No. 4956/2013. The merger is considered compliant with the national competition laws, indicating a crucial development in the regulation of competitive practices in the dairy industry.
